Can anyone kindly suggest Process for Background check. Suppose we interviewed a candidate and he is selected then can we make background check from the co. where he is currently working but this can hamper his reputation in the company further where he is working if he doesnt get selected. And what exactly is the difference between Reference check and Background Check.

At the time of interview itself you may check with candidate whether we can go ahead with BG check with his/her present employment. Upon his/her confirmation we have to act. Also if we need to go for BG checks, only if we are completely ok with the person (I mean ok for recruitment). Even if you not doing any check prior to recruitment we will do post BG check and get the confirmation. In case of any negative feedback we will go for termination. There is nothing harm in that. This is what generally happens in the industry.
